How To Write Resume For Staff Appraiser
- Highlight your experience and skills in advanced valuation techniques, such as comparable sales analysis, income capitalization, and cost approach.
- Showcase your ability to conduct thorough property inspections and gather relevant market data.
- Emphasize your experience in preparing detailed appraisal reports that meet industry standards and regulatory requirements.
- Demonstrate your communication and presentation skills by highlighting your ability to effectively present and defend appraisal findings to various stakeholders.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’s) For Staff Appraiser
What are the key responsibilities of a Staff Appraiser?
The key responsibilities of a Staff Appraiser include utilizing advanced valuation techniques, conducting property inspections and market research, preparing appraisal reports, presenting findings to stakeholders, and managing a team of appraisers.
What are the educational requirements for a Staff Appraiser?
A Staff Appraiser typically requires a Bachelor’s degree in Real Estate or a related field.
What are the career prospects for a Staff Appraiser?
With experience and additional certifications, a Staff Appraiser can advance to roles such as Senior Appraiser, Appraisal Manager, or Chief Appraiser.
What are the salary expectations for a Staff Appraiser?
The salary expectations for a Staff Appraiser can vary depending on experience, location, and company size. According to Salary.com, the average base salary for a Staff Appraiser in the United States is around $65,000.
What are the in-demand skills for a Staff Appraiser?
In-demand skills for a Staff Appraiser include proficiency in advanced valuation techniques, strong communication and presentation skills, and experience with commercial and residential property appraisal.
